Ally, a black lab golden retriever mix, was taken from an animal shelter the day before she was to be euthanized to become a service dog for Maureen, a totally blind quadriplegic.
The book tells, through beautiful illustrations and text, what a typical day is like for Ally. Told in the first person, Ally teaches children all the tasks that she does to assist Maureen. Children will learn about teamwork, disability and capability of both the dog and master in this unique book, which will inspire both young and old readers.
